Great for DIY Dipoles
I used these adapters to make some dipoles. I made a 10m and a 20m dipole with them and they performed excellent. I compared the dipoles to a 40m efhw and I believe the dipoles outperformed the end fed slightly. I have zero complaints with the build quality, and they are affordable enough to buy multiples.

T**Y
Works
One of two in the pack was pitted, and flaking. The other seemed fine. Working as a homebrew dipole. Wrap the wire through the little holes a few times for strain relief (as seen on N6CC's site).
T**C
Inverted V 20 meter dipole with less than 1.2 SWR
Like everyone else, I used this to make a 20 meter QRP dipole antenna for my portable operations. I used a 3/16 drill bit and drilled a hole between the terminals then attached a carabiner clip to it so there would be no strain on the wire. I used about 17' of 20 gauge wire for each side and deployed for fine tuning. I was able to trim the ends to get the phone portion of the band to 1.0 SWR and the digital portion of the band to 1.2 As you can tell, it has a low Q (wide bandwidth) to cover the entire band without an antenna tuner. It would not be resonant on any other band without one. Since you get 5 to a pack, make 5 bands. Also in the picture I have a female BNC to SO239 adapter because all of my cables are RG-8X with PL-259 ends. These things are great for dipoles. Between wire, carabiner and adapter I have less than $10 in it and it works amazing and is super light weight.
